It's CSS PLAYOFFS Time.  The format has not changed much from last year, to here it is :)

2010 CSS PLAYOFFS - RULES

1.  CSS Playoffs will include the 10 CSS games from Thursday, June 3, 2010 to Wednesday, June 17, 2010.  If any games are spoiled or pre-empted during this time, June 25th will be the makeup day.
2.  Only players who are "above the line" after Wednesday, June 2, 2010 are eligible for playoffs.  Players who are not above the line are welcome to continue to participate in CSS, and the year-long spreadsheet will continue to be calculated.
3.  During the playoff period, players will be ranked by their "Playoff Average", and the player with the highest average after the 10 games will be crowned 2010 CSS Champion.  "Playoff Average" will be computed in the following manner, and is explained below:

Playoff Average = Points Average During Playoffs + Bonus Points

Points Average During Playoff:  A player's point average is the number of CSS points earned each day, divided by the number of games played.  During the playoffs, all point multipliers are eliminated with the exception of multipliers for a DSW or QSW.

Bonus Points:  Players earn playoff bonus points based on their season-long CSS performance in both points average and money earned.  The top player in both points and money will earn 10 bonus points, 2nd place earns 9 bonus points, 3rd place earns 8 points....down to 10th place, which earns 1 bonus point.  The number of bonus points for each player will be calculated based on standings closing on Wednedsay, June 3rd.

Example:  Let's say that in the 10-day playoff period, my scoring average is 62.50.  Since I am first in year-long points (10 points) and 6th in money (5 points), I would earn 15 bonus points.  My playoff average is then 77.50 points.

4.  A player must play at least 5 of the 10 CSS Playoff games in order to qualify to be CSS Champion.
5.  Money earned during playoff games will not figure into playoff standings, but will continue to count towards the season-long spreadsheet.
